Menu

SAP Function Module MSS_GET_SQLEXPLAIN

MS SQL Server get explain for a given SQL statement

The Function Module MSS_GET_SQLEXPLAIN (MS SQL Server get explain for a given SQL statement) is a standard Function Module in SAP ERP and is part of the function group STUS within the package STUS.

Technical Information

Function Module MSS_GET_SQLEXPLAIN
Short Text MS SQL Server get explain for a given SQL statement
Function Group STUS
Package STUS
Module Type Remote-Enabled

Importing Parameters

These are the IMPORTING parameters of this function module.

Parameter Name Type Associated Type Default Value Short Text
CON_NAME LIKE DBCON-CON_NAME 'DEFAULT' Logical name of a Database Connection
FINAL_COMMAND LIKE MSQEXPLAIN-LONGSQLTXT
GURU_AT_WORK LIKE MSSHELP-MIRRFLAG ' '
NOEXEC_X LIKE MSQEXPLAIN-NOEXEC ' '
SCHEMA TYPE MSSSCHEMA SPACE Target Schema
SHOWPLAN_X LIKE MSQEXPLAIN-SHOWPLANON 'X'
SP_NAME LIKE MSQOBJECTS-NAME ' '
STATIO_X LIKE MSQEXPLAIN-IOSTATSON 'X'
TIMESTATS_X LIKE MSQEXPLAIN-TIMESTATON 'X'
TRACE_FLAGS LIKE MSQEXPLAIN-TRACEFLAGS ' '

Exporting Parameters

This function module does not define any EXPORTING parameters.

Changing Parameters

This function module does not define any CHANGING parameters.

Table Parameters

These are the TABLE parameters of this function module.

Parameter Name Type Associated Type Default Value Short Text
EXPLAIN_RESULT LIKE MSQSTPRTXT
SP_PARAMS LIKE MSQSPPARAM
STMT_LINES LIKE MSQSQLCODE MS SQL server structure to get the sp text

Exceptions

These are the Exceptions of this function module.

Exception Name Short Text
CONNECT_ERROR Can't connect
DB_ERROR Some database error occurred.
INTERNAL_ERROR Internal ADBC error.
NOT_RUNNING_ON_MSSQL Not MSSQL